description abstractThis paper presents a parametric study of the effect of delamination, and of initial imperfection, on the overall nonlinear behavior of laminated composite beams. The study is based on geometrical nonlinear analysis with the Von-Karman kinematic approach. It is shown that the bifurcation point provides not more than an indication of the buckling behavior, and that the full nonlinear analysis is needed for predicting the load-carrying capacity. It was also found that the delaminated beam is sensitive to initial imperfection.
